Hunton Andrews Kurth LLP Partner Juan C. Enjamio has been included in Florida Trend magazine’s 2025 Florida 500 (FL500), an annual list that recognizes the 500 most influential business leaders in Florida. The FL500 aims to highlight individuals who have made significant impacts in various sectors, including business, government, education, and nonprofit organizations. Enjamio was selected as an industry leader who invests in his community and contributes to the state’s growth and advancement.

As a partner in the firm’s Labor & Employment Team in the Miami office, Enjamio represents domestic and international clients in discrimination and harassment lawsuits, wage and hour collective actions, enforcement of non-competition agreements, and unfair labor practices cases. He also counsels domestic and international clients on employment, labor, and commercial issues.

Committed to giving back, Enjamio spearheaded the firm’s First-Generation Pathway program in Miami that led to the establishment of a scholarship for outstanding first-generation law students and he leads local mentoring initiatives. Enjamio also serves on the board of St. John Bosco Leadership and Learning Center.
